Invasive Japanese Knotweed

There is an infestation of Japanese Knotweed, between the new development on the old Greenwood Hotel, Bowling Green and Craven Court. This as spread via the Rhizomes over a number of years and is now encroaching the boundary wall of Lower Makinson Fold. If it penetrates the boundary it will compromise the integrity of the wall and invade the private land of Lower Makinson Fold. This threat of invasion by Japanese Knotweed emanates of Bolton MBC or Bolton at Home land, and as such should be remediated by the land owners.
